Not too big (3.0?) centered about 5 miles north of here.Bill G.https://www.blogger.com/profile/04142837879175561312noreply@blogger.comtag:blogger.com,1999:blog-5995532066584316410.post-121767431906330292013-05-09T17:21:13.495-05:002013-05-09T17:21:13.495-05:00Gravlax.Gravlax.Lemonade714https://www.blogger.com/profile/13642909374639570868noreply@blogger.comtag:blogger.com,1999:blog-5995532066584316410.post-8646517207624847742013-05-09T16:49:39.273-05:002013-05-09T16:49:39.273-05:00Lox (or belly lox)itself is very salty, as it is a...Lox (or belly lox)itself is very salty, as it is a heavily brined fish. Nova Lox is smoked lox containing much less salt. In restaurants it is the nova, or straight smoked salmon people are served when they order lox and bagels.Lemonade714https://www.blogger.com/profile/13642909374639570868noreply@blogger.comtag:blogger.com,1999:blog-5995532066584316410.post-63989449541028933782013-05-09T15:04:50.677-05:002013-05-09T15:04:50.677-05:00Hello everybody.
